Not Me Monday - The Dog's Revenge

So last week I told you (all three of you) about how I didn't forget the dog food in my trunk the whole weekend (She still got fed, don't worry! You can go back and read it if you'd like). Well, on Valentine's night she got her revenge. First, I'll tell you what happened, then we can discuss what I didn't do about it...

Jamie was awake all night long. Mark let her out at least twice. This is pretty unusual since, as a middle aged yellow lab, she needs her 17 hours of sleep per day or she's just not herself. On Monday morning we were able to piece the story together pretty quickly.

Seems that the two plastic gallon jugs of apple cider we'd been saving in the pantry had been fermenting for months. I'm no chemist, but I do know that when liquids ferment, they release CO2 gas (hence the bubbly in your beer and other drinks). The pressure inside the sealed jugs got to be too much and they burst that night. Our sweet, helpful (and always hungry) lab went right in and licked some of the mess up for us. How kind of her. In the process, she got a bit tipsy as would anyone who drank nearly two gallons of cider beer. She then proceeded to drunkenly stagger around our house and track the remaining cider all over our slate floors. So here's what I didn't do:

I did not laugh out loud at the thought that my dog spent her Valentine's Day like many American singles - alone and drunk in her living room. I did not swear under my breath (dangit did just fine thankyouverymuch) when I realized that I would be the one on clean-up duty. I did not simply close the door to the pantry for several hours and procrastinate on said clean-up duty. I also did not almost fall over when I finally opened the door to the (unventilated) pantry because it smelled like the trash compactor at a brewery.

Finally, it had not been so long since I'd last mopped that I couldn't find the bucket. And even if it had, I most certainly did not use a spare plastic trash can as a bucket. Nope. No way. Not me. :-)
